Elilan calls for eradication of child marriage
[TamilNet, Sunday, 17 July 2005, 08:29 GMT]
"Child marriage is still common in some areas in Eachchilampathu division. We are taking action to stop this social ill. It is the duty of every responsible citizen to eradicate this menace," said Mr.S.Elilan, LTTE Trincomalee district political head participating as the chief guest at the Women Confluence organised by the Eachchilampathu Women Development Organization Saturday.
Trincomalee District Fund for Affected Students collaborated in holding this event at Eachchilampathu Sri Senbaga Maha Vidiyalayam.

Mr. Elilan said child marriage has been a major problem in this division. LTTE has taken steps to educate the villagers in this regard. He appealed to women to extend their co-operation to the authorities to stop child marriages. More than one thousand women participated in the event.  Ms Kaaronja, speaking at the event

Ms Kaaronja said in her opening address that women in the northeast are facing several difficulties. Women should come forward to win their basic and fundamental rights. Mr. Thevadachcham also spoke. Workshops were held on themes: Women and Education, Women and Economy and Women and Health.
